Basswood Capital Management L.L.C. bought a new position in Atlantic Union Bankshares Co. (NASDAQ:AUBAP – Free Report) during the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The firm bought 190,680 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$8,068,000.
A number of other hedge funds and other institutional investors have also recently added to or reduced their stakes in AUBAP. Bank of New York Mellon Corp acquired a new stake in Atlantic Union Bankshares during the second quarter worth about $57,151,000. Global Retirement Partners LLC acquired a new position in shares of Atlantic Union Bankshares in the 2nd quarter valued at about $206,000. OneDigital Investment Advisors LLC purchased a new stake in shares of Atlantic Union Bankshares during the 2nd quarter worth about $392,000. Deutsche Bank AG purchased a new stake in shares of Atlantic Union Bankshares during the 2nd quarter worth about $6,410,000. Finally, BlackRock Inc. acquired a new stake in Atlantic Union Bankshares during the 2nd quarter worth approximately $883,523,000.

About Atlantic Union Bankshares
Atlantic Union Bankshares Corporation is a bank holding company and the parent of Atlantic Union Bank, a regional financial institution serving primarily Virginia and select markets in North Carolina, Maryland and the District of Columbia. The company offers a full suite of banking services to individuals, small- and mid-sized businesses, and commercial clients, including deposit accounts, consumer and commercial lending, treasury management, mortgage financing and wealth management services. Atlantic Union Bank emphasizes a relationship-driven approach, combining local decision-making authority with digital banking capabilities to support day-to-day financial needs and long-term growth objectives.
Founded on the heritage of Union Bank & Trust, which traces its origins to Winchester, Virginia in the early 20th century, Atlantic Union Bankshares emerged from the merger of Union Bankshares and Xenith Bank in 2018.
